分享一波 ZooKeeper 面試題
- ZooKeeper是什麼?
- ZooKeeper提供了什麼?
- Zookeeper文件系統
- ZAB協議?
- 四種類型的數據節點 Znode
- Zookeeper Watcher 機制 -- 數據變動通知
- 客戶端註冊Watcher實現
- 服務端處理Watcher實現
- 客戶端回調Watcher
- ACL權限控制機制 UGO(User/Group/Others) ACL(Access Control List)訪問控制列表
- Chroot特性
- 會話管理
- 服務器角色 Leader Follower Observer
- Zookeeper 下 Server工做狀態
- 數據同步 直接差別化同步(DIFF同步) 先回滾再差別化同步(TRUNC+DIFF同步) 僅回滾同步(TRUNC同步) 全量同步(SNAP同步)
- zookeeper是如何保證事務的順序一致性的?
- 分佈式集羣中爲何會有Master?
- zk節點宕機如何處理?
- zookeeper負載均衡和nginx負載均衡區別
- Zookeeper有哪幾種幾種部署模式?
- 集羣最少要幾臺機器,集羣規則是怎樣的?
- 集羣支持動態添加機器嗎?
- Zookeeper對節點的watch監聽通知是永久的嗎?爲何不是永久的?
- Zookeeper的java客戶端都有哪些?
- chubby是什麼,和zookeeper比你怎麼看?
- 說幾個zookeeper經常使用的命令。
- ZAB和Paxos算法的聯繫與區別?
- Zookeeper的典型應用場景
Zookeeper 面試題答案
關注微信公衆號:【搜雲庫技術團隊】java
公衆號微信ID:souyunkunode
回覆關鍵字:zk0519 便可獲取
nginx
歡迎關注本站公眾號,獲取更多信息